Hello,

I started recently using Ansys Aqwa (Hydrodynamic diffraction), my goal is to realize a numerical simulation about a buoy which is linked (very small gap) to a fixed tower. The results I get show that the Buoy tilts up and down in the model if it were a ship. However, in reality the buoy only act with the heave of the wave in a completely vertical movement. Also, it seems that the structure interaction between the buoy and fixed tower, physically absent.
What is the possible config to give the buoy only a vertical movement ?
